Transaction 2af63ffac29488361fc0e7554a6c9b136b9462e789b1c9b7a1344e290fbc6806

1 Input
2 Outputs
  • 2af63ffac29488361fc0e7554a6c9b136b9462e789b1c9b7a1344e290fbc6806:0
  • value  259928103
    address  2N1Xt9uZCqR57ftUsbQdwtTtP6joKZek7zQ
  • 2af63ffac29488361fc0e7554a6c9b136b9462e789b1c9b7a1344e290fbc6806:1
  • value  1624306
    address  2NG42rrJ5tzbjPL1A8cSpPFngbwZReZhzuM